## Welcome to Snackroute Support!

Snackroute is our restock planner — it tells drivers which vending machines need topping up and in what order. Most tickets are about stale inventory counts; usually a machine just missed its nightly sync. To peek at raw machine data, query the Fillmeter service from the support console using the shared read-only key below.

API key for yahig-tadup: kto7_ubizbYm

Welcome to the Lanternleaf consent banner program. Plugin authors must register each banner variant before rollout so the Driftgate compliance checker can validate copy, locale coverage, and dismissal behavior. Please test against the staging consent ledger rather than production; consent records are immutable once written, and malformed entries cannot be purged without a formal review. To connect your local plugin harness to the staging ledger, configure your client with the connection string below.

replica DSN, hadug-yajep: postgresql://aldiel_svc:W4u8z42Jo5IFtG@db-1656.torvacorp.local:5432/holael

TICKET: Schema registry rejects valid event envelopes

Priority: High. Component: Fennwick event-schema-registry.

Since the Tuesday deploy, the registry's compat check fails any envelope with optional nested fields, even when the producer schema matches. Repro: register v4 of orders.shipped, then publish — validation throws on every message. Likely the resolver caches the old schema hash. Check the compat matrix in the Larkspur docs before touching resolver code. The failing build token is below.

build token for tawip-yageg: htk9_92ac43d42

This page documents the artifact lineage for the fan-out backpressure change. When downstream webhook consumers slow, the dispatcher now sheds load by deferring low-priority notifications to a spill queue rather than buffering unbounded in memory. The security-relevant detail: the spill queue is encrypted at rest and drained by the same signed worker image, so provenance is unchanged end to end. All artifacts are built in the hermetic pipeline and attested. The attested build is identified by the token below.

trace token, yahag-kageg: htk9_b6b3bc753